     37 static void
     38 nv10_devinit_meminit(struct nvkm_devinit *init)
     39 {
     40 	struct nvkm_subdev *subdev = &init->subdev;
     41 	struct nvkm_device *device = subdev->device;
     42 	static const int mem_width[] = { 0x10, 0x00, 0x20 };
     43 	int mem_width_count;
     44 	uint32_t patt = 0xdeadbeef;
     45 	struct io_mapping *fb;
     46 	int i, j, k;
     47 
     48 	if (device->card_type >= NV_11 && device->chipset >= 0x17)
     49 		mem_width_count = 3;
     50 	else
     51 		mem_width_count = 2;
     52 
     53 	/* Map the framebuffer aperture */
     54 	fb = fbmem_init(device);
     55 	if (!fb) {
     56 		nvkm_error(subdev, "failed to map fb\n");
     57 		return;
     58 	}
     59 
     60 	nvkm_wr32(device, NV10_PFB_REFCTRL, NV10_PFB_REFCTRL_VALID_1);
     61 
     62 	/* Probe memory bus width */
     63 	for (i = 0; i < mem_width_count; i++) {
     64 		nvkm_mask(device, NV04_PFB_CFG0, 0x30, mem_width[i]);
     65 
     66 		for (j = 0; j < 4; j++) {
     67 			for (k = 0; k < 4; k++)
     68 				fbmem_poke(fb, 0x1c, 0);
     69 
     70 			fbmem_poke(fb, 0x1c, patt);
     71 			fbmem_poke(fb, 0x3c, 0);
     72 
     73 			if (fbmem_peek(fb, 0x1c) == patt)
     74 				goto mem_width_found;
     75 		}
     76 	}
     77 
     78 mem_width_found:
     79 	patt <<= 1;
     80 
     81 	/* Probe amount of installed memory */
     82 	for (i = 0; i < 4; i++) {
     83 		int off = nvkm_rd32(device, 0x10020c) - 0x100000;
     84 
     85 		fbmem_poke(fb, off, patt);
     86 		fbmem_poke(fb, 0, 0);
     87 
     88 		fbmem_peek(fb, 0);
     89 		fbmem_peek(fb, 0);
     90 		fbmem_peek(fb, 0);
     91 		fbmem_peek(fb, 0);
     92 
     93 		if (fbmem_peek(fb, off) == patt)
     94 			goto amount_found;
     95 	}
     96 
     97 	/* IC missing - disable the upper half memory space. */
     98 	nvkm_mask(device, NV04_PFB_CFG0, 0x1000, 0);
     99 
    100 amount_found:
    101 	fbmem_fini(fb);
    102 }
